Generally speaking I don't think we should allow for female citizen animations to be used for CPs AT ALL. Female CP characters should have the default CP animation set ALWAYS. It looks very strange and, realistically, even the female CPs would be indistinguishable from the male CPs while in uniform.

To answer this question though, adding these things in is going to be a hard no for right now. While we do have a bunch of very talented programmers, modelers, and other such developers- animators are something we are very short on. Honestly, there are probably very few people who even understand how to correctly do valve biped skeletal animation sequences. They're very complicated, especially with blending and other things.

This is why we don't have the cat update (no animations or animators). I've been tempted to do the skeltal animations with valve IK but honestly it would be a huge pain.
